| Iscar Offers A Revolutionary Line Of Slitting Cutters Applying Tang-Grip Technology And The Durability Of Sumo Tec Grades Iscar at this time offers a family of high-performance slitting tools that couple the convenience and security of Tang-Grip clamping with the increased sturdiness of the brand new Sumo Tec insert grades. The concept, already proven successful in Tang-Grip parting tools, has now been spread to slitting cutters. In the patented Tang-Grip clamping system, inserts are press-fit into their pockets with a distinct hand tool, and are retained solidly in place without having the need for clamps, upper jaws or set screws that can weaken the insert and impede chip flow. The pocket design uses cutting forces to retain the insert seated securely in position, preventing any danger of insert pull-out. The Tang-Grip clamping system also fosters additional accurate slitting cuts plus increased pocket and insert life. Iscar's Sumo Tec insert grades feature a special post-coating treatment which substantially increases tool life and reliability. Unveiled in late 2007, the unique Sumo Tec treatment flattens the insert's coated surface to eradicate microscopic stress raisers, reduce heat and friction and improve chip flow. The result is improved toughness and opposition to chipping and built-up edge, all leading to longer tool lifespan. The golden-colored side on Sumo Tec inserts eases wear detection. Size for size, Tangslit cutters give more teeth than Iscar's SGSF cutters, allowing higher feed rates. Their greater rigidity leads to straighter, more accurate cuts and less vibration even in large-diameter cutters. The revolutionary Tangslit TGSF cutters come in 100 to 160 mm diameters, 3 and 4 mm widths and can accommodate the exact same assortment of inserts as Tang-Grip parting tools. Some other sizes will be added. Obtainable Sumo Tec grades for Tangslit cutters include: IC808, with a tough submicron substrate below a Sumo Tec TiAlN PVD coating, delivering excellent resistance to impact loads and built-up edge. This grade is recommended for slitting heat resistant alloys, austenitic stainless steel, hard alloys and carbon steel. IC830, supplying extra toughness for heavier parting & grooving including interrupted cuts. It is appropriate for any stainless steel and high temperature alloys. IC908, a hard, fine-grain substrate with excellent chipping resistance, combined with a new Sumo Tec TiAlN PVD coating. It is perfect for nodular or gray cast iron. IC928 and 928A, PVD TiAlN-coated tough grades suited for stainless steel, high temperature alloys and other alloy steels. These grades are likewise favored for interrupted cuts and heavy operations. Each Tangslit and Tang-Grip inserts are presented in J- or C-type chipformer geometries from Iscar. The Most Recent In Carbide Endmill Configuration In A Extensive And Prosperous Family From Iscar Manufacturers and die & mold shops can eliminate chatter problems in many milling operations with Iscar's new Chatterfree endmills. The cutters' variable-pitch flute pattern eliminates harmonic vibration, the main source of chatter. This enables faster cutting and finer finish in rough or finish slotting, shoulder milling and cavity milling. Some Of Advancements In Carbide Inserts From Iscar Iscar is introducing a new unique milling system with tangential, clamped, butterfly-shaped LNKX carbide inserts. The butterfly-shaped insert has significant advantages compared to the current flat, square shapes. The new geometry has more cutting edges, positive rake face, reduced cutting forces resulting in higher performance. Cutting Edge Tools And Carbide Insert Arrangements From Iscar To Better Improve The Machining Process Iscar is introducing Penta 34 carbide inserts with a new PB chipformer. The PB chipformer features a single cavity with a positive rake, neutral shoulder angle, and a honed edge. It is actually a C-type chipformer with a different frontal edge.
